Teachers2008-2009 Summer Band and Orchestra Programs Information Meeting04-21-2008 Ø Talk with Principal about use of the facility Schedule dates into the D11 calendar with Rosie Gigax in Community Relations Office Ø Develop and distribute flyer Dates and o Cost o Target group/groups o Instruments taught o Books and/or materials Ø Accounting and finance o Checks will be made to your school site. o Checks will be deposited into your SSA account. o You will fill out an extra work form for your payment. o Left over money can be used for your school program. Ø Marketing of your program o Post information on the D11 website. o Send information to Judy McIntire for press release. o Send to KRCC for Public Service Announcements o Send to the Gazette for their GO section. Ø Support to implement your program o Youth Symphony o Volunteer music staff o CSU Pueblo music staff o High School Music Students _____________________________________________________________________________________ The two approaches for programming: If you hold the program at your school and have the students make their checks out to you, you will have them registration fees deposited into SSA account and then your school will pay you on an extra work form at the rate of $23.41 an hour. If there is money left in the SSA account, you can use it for your band program next year. To reserve the space for your class, have someone in your building enter the times of your class into the district 11 web calendar so that others do not think that the room is available and book your room for some other event. If you run the program as an entrepreneur and have the students make out the checks to you, you have to pay for the space and you can’t use the D11 PONY or e-mail for advertising. You keep all of the money but you are treated like an outside business. You must book your program with Rosie Gigax in Community Relations (520-2335) and she will work out the details for you in regards to renting the space that you need. | |
